Grad Night Gourmet: Top Menu Ideas for Bellevue Graduation Catering

Bellevue graduation catering sets the tone for a polished grad party that feels as special as the milestone it celebrates. Thoughtfully designed menus help students and families showcase personality while keeping stress low on the big day.

Below is a structured overview of core options, price ranges, and service models to guide your planning for a Bellevue graduation catering grad party catering menu.

Package Type Serving Style Typical Price per Person Best For
Classic Buffet Self-serve hot and cold stations $22–$38 Large groups, interactive dining
Plated Dinner Server-led seated service $35–$65 Formal feel, controlled portions
Family-Style Pitcher Service Shared platters passed at tables $28–$50 Balance of comfort and intimacy
Hors D'oeuvres & Stations Food trucks, mobile espresso, build-your-own $15–$40 Modern, flexible grazing experience

Logistics, Timing, and Service Models

Timing your Bellevue graduation catering grad party catering menu around ceremony start and photo sessions helps avoid guest wait times. Buffet lines should be wide enough to prevent bottlenecks, while plated services benefit from precise seating schedules. Mobile catering teams that handle setup, chafing dishes, and breakdown free hosts to focus on celebration moments rather than logistics.

Final Planning Recommendations for Bellevue Graduation Catering

  • Confirm guest count and preferred service style early to select the right package.
  • Share dietary restrictions with the caterer at least two weeks before the event.
  • Schedule tasting sessions to finalize the Bellevue graduation catering grad party catering menu and adjust portions.
  • Coordinate event timeline with the caterer for course flow, speeches, and cake service.
  • Confirm staffing, equipment needs, and permit requirements with the caterer and venue.

FAQ

Reader questions

What graduation menu options work best for a small backyard gathering in Bellevue?

For a small backyard gathering, family-style platters, grazing stations, and interactive taco or build-your-own bars offer relaxed dining that encourages conversation without requiring formal seating.

How do caterers handle dietary restrictions like vegan, gluten-free, and nut-free requests for a grad party menu?

Professional caterers label allergens, offer clearly marked gluten-free and vegan stations, and prepare dedicated nut-free dishes using separate equipment to minimize cross-contact.

What is a realistic budget range per person for Bellevue graduation catering at a grad party with a full menu?

Expect $25–$55 per person for a balanced menu with buffet or family-style service, while plated dinners and premium beverages typically land between $45–$70 per guest depending on ingredients and service level.

Can I include drinks and alcohol in the graduation catering package, and what should I know about permits in Bellevue?

Yes, most caterers can include alcohol, but in Bellevue you may need a temporary event permit and must follow state liquor laws regarding service, ID checks, and noise restrictions.
